    You would be burned at the stake for this in Colorado. It's interesting seeing the different mentality in different areas of the country. I'm sure elevation has something to do with it. Takes a lot longer to grow the higher up you go so damage remains much longer. Trees are a quick easy problem to deal with. Carry a saw and cut it off the trail so that everyone else doesn't need to go around it widening the road. I'm far from a damn hippy but following stay the trail practices is helpful in keeping access to these roads. To many greenies trying to make places wilderness areas.
